Abstract

Provided is a microwave and ultrashort wave-based multi-probe modular human rehabilitation physiotherapy system, which relates to the technical field of physiotherapy equipment. The system comprises a patient support apparatus (2) and a movable physiotherapy apparatus (1). The patient support apparatus (2) comprises a physiotherapy bed, and the movable physiotherapy apparatus (1) comprises physiotherapy modules (3). Each physiotherapy module (3) is provided with an independent physiotherapy probe (4), and the physiotherapy probe (4) comprises a microwave physiotherapy head (6) and an ultra-short wave physiotherapy head (7). The physiotherapy module (3) comprises a semi-annular support erected above the physiotherapy bed, and the semi-annular support is provided with a swing driving mechanism configured to drive the physiotherapy probe (4) to swing left and right; two ends of the semi-annular support are respectively arranged at two sides of the physiotherapy bed, and the physiotherapy bed is provided with a transverse movement driving mechanism configured to drive the semi-annular support to move along the length direction of the physiotherapy bed. The transverse movement driving mechanism and the swing driving mechanism cooperate to achieve multi-angle and multi-direction adjustment of a physiotherapy position in a three-dimensional space.

[0003] Microwave physiotherapy and ultrashort wave physiotherapy are two common physical treatment methods, each with its own unique efficacy and indications. Microwave physiotherapy can promote blood circulation, accelerate metabolism, relieve pain and inflammation by the action of high-frequency electromagnetic waves; while ultrashort wave physiotherapy can heat deep tissues to achieve the purpose of anti-inflammatory, detumescence and analgesia. However, existing microwave and ultrashort wave physiotherapy equipment mostly adopts fixed probe design, and the physiotherapy position is fixed, which is difficult to adjust flexibly according to the specific condition of patients and rehabilitation needs.

[0033] As shown in FIGS. 1-14, a microwave and ultrashort wave based multi-probe modular human body rehabilitation physiotherapy system 100, comprising a patient support device 2, a movable physiotherapy device 1, the patient support device 2 comprising a physiotherapy bed 34 for the human body to lie flat, the movable physiotherapy device 1 comprising a physiotherapy module 3 movably installed above the physiotherapy bed 34, the physiotherapy module 3 being installed side by side along the length direction of the physiotherapy bed 34 in multiple groups, and each physiotherapy module 3 being installed with an independent physiotherapy probe 4; the physiotherapy probe 4 comprising a microwave physiotherapy head 6 and an ultrashort wave physiotherapy head 7; the microwave physiotherapy head 6 is used for microwave physiotherapy, and the ultrashort wave physiotherapy head 7 is used for ultrashort wave physiotherapy. The working principle of the microwave physiotherapy instrument (i.e. the microwave physiotherapy head 6) is mainly realized through thermal effect and biological effect; when the microwave acts on the body tissue, it will cause high-frequency oscillation of ions, water molecules and dipoles in the tissue cells. This high-frequency oscillation will generate heat, which in turn produces a thermal effect on the tissue; when the microwave output energy is low and the radiant heat energy is small, it can enhance local blood circulation, speed up local metabolism, and enhance local immunity, thereby effectively improving local blood circulation, promoting edema absorption, and relieving inflammation and pain.

[0034] The structure of the microwave physiotherapy instrument (i.e. the microwave physiotherapy head 6) mainly includes a microwave generator, a radiator, a control system, a safety protection device, and auxiliary equipment: (1) the microwave generator: responsible for generating microwave energy, is the core component of the physiotherapy instrument; (2) the radiator or probe: transmits microwave energy to the treatment site of the patient's body; the radiator is usually designed to fit the body curve to ensure effective transmission of microwave energy; (3) the control system: including the main control console, the control panel, the display screen, etc., used to set the treatment parameters (such as microwave output power, treatment time, etc.) and monitor the treatment process; (4) the safety protection device: to ensure the safety of the patient during treatment, such as overheat protection, overload protection, etc.; (5) auxiliary equipment: such as the physiotherapy bed 34, the mounting bracket, etc., used to support the patient's body and fix the microwave physiotherapy instrument to improve the treatment effect and the comfort of the patient. The above-mentioned microwave physiotherapy instrument (i.e. the microwave physiotherapy head 6) acts on the human body tissue through the thermal effect and biological effect of the microwave, achieving the treatment effect of improving local blood circulation, promoting edema absorption, relieving inflammation and pain, etc.

[0035] The main structural components of the ultrashort wave physiotherapy apparatus (i.e., the ultrashort wave physiotherapy head 7) include: (1) Control unit: including the main console, control panel, display screen, etc., for setting physiotherapy parameters, displaying patient information, and monitoring the physiotherapy process; (2) Energy source: ultrashort wave generator, generating electromagnetic waves in the ultrashort wave frequency band (usually 30MHz to 300MHz); (3) Transmission system: including cables, waveguides, or antennas, etc., for transmitting ultrashort wave energy from the generator to the treatment head; (4) Treatment head: the component that directly acts on the patient's body surface, usually designed to be adjustable in angle and position for precise alignment of the treatment area; (5) Safety protection device: such as overload protection, overheat protection, etc., to ensure that the device automatically cuts off the power supply in abnormal conditions, ensuring patient safety. The working principle of the ultrashort wave physiotherapy apparatus (i.e., the ultrashort wave physiotherapy head 7) is as follows: The ultrashort wave physiotherapy apparatus uses electromagnetic waves in the ultrashort wave frequency band to treat the human body. When the ultrashort wave acts on the human body, its energy is absorbed by the tissue and converted into heat energy, raising the temperature of the local tissue, dilating blood vessels, and accelerating blood circulation, thereby achieving the effects of anti-inflammatory, analgesic, and promoting tissue repair. The specific process is as follows: (1) Electromagnetic wave radiation: the ultrashort wave generator generates electromagnetic waves of a specific frequency, which are transmitted to the treatment head through the transmission system. (2) Energy coupling: the treatment head radiates electromagnetic waves to the patient's body surface, and part of the electromagnetic waves penetrate the skin and enter the internal tissue. (3) Energy absorption and conversion: the polar molecules (such as water molecules) in the tissue vibrate under the action of electromagnetic waves, generating heat and raising the temperature of the local tissue. (4) Biological effect: the temperature rise leads to the dilation of blood vessels, acceleration of blood circulation, promotion of metabolism and absorption of inflammation, thereby achieving the treatment purpose.

[0036] The physiotherapy module 3 includes a semi-ring-shaped support 35 erected above the physiotherapy bed 34, and the physiotherapy probe 4 is movably installed on the semi-ring-shaped support 35 and can slide left and right along the semi-ring-shaped support 35, and the physiotherapy position of the physiotherapy probe 4 is installed opposite to the physiotherapy bed 34; wherein the physiotherapy probe 4 includes a probe shell, the probe shell is detachably installed on the probe seat, a wiring port is installed on one side of the probe shell, and a ring of spotlight is installed at the bottom of the probe shell corresponding to the physiotherapy position, which is used to indicate the physiotherapy area; the detachable design of the physiotherapy probe 4 and the indication of the spotlight have the following advantages: (1) convenient maintenance and replacement: the detachable design of the physiotherapy probe 4 makes the cleaning, maintenance and replacement of the probe more convenient and fast. When the probe fails or needs to be upgraded, it can be quickly replaced, reducing the impact on the overall system. (2) Improve treatment accuracy: the ring of spotlight installed at the bottom of the probe shell can clearly indicate the physiotherapy area, help medical staff accurately aim at the treatment site, and improve the accuracy and effect of treatment. (3) Enhance user experience: the indication of the spotlight can also make patients more intuitive to understand the treatment process, reduce nervousness, and improve the treatment experience. The semi-ring-shaped support 35 includes a left support 8 and a right support 9 installed oppositely, and a positioning structure 10 matched with each other is installed at the top combined position of the left support 8 and the right support 9, and the positioning structure 10 includes a positioning protrusion installed on the combined surface of the left support 8 and a positioning groove opened on the combined surface of the right support 9.

[0037] The positioning structure design of the semi-ring-shaped support 35 has the following advantages: (1) improve the structural stability: the positioning structure 10 (including the positioning protrusion and the positioning groove) at the top combined position of the left support 8 and the right support 9 can ensure accurate positioning of the support during assembly, improve the structural stability and load-bearing capacity of the entire semi-ring-shaped support 35. (2) Convenient installation and disassembly: the design of the positioning structure 10 makes the installation and disassembly process of the support more convenient and fast, reducing the operation difficulty and time cost. (3) Improve equipment durability: accurate positioning and stable structure can help reduce wear and looseness of the support during long-term use, thereby prolonging the service life of the equipment and improving the durability of the equipment.

[0038] In one embodiment, the left support 8 and the right support 9 each include a support seat 12 located on both sides of the physiotherapy bed 34 and an arc-shaped support housing 11, the bottom of the arc-shaped support housing 11 is provided with a swing sliding groove 13 along the swinging direction of the physiotherapy probe 4, a swing seat 14 is movably installed in the swing sliding groove 13, and the physiotherapy probe 4 is detachably installed at the bottom of the swing seat 14; by detachably installing the physiotherapy probe 4 at the bottom of the swing seat 14 and allowing the swing seat 14 to move in the swing sliding groove 13 of the arc-shaped support housing 11, the flexibility and stability of the physiotherapy probe 4 during left and right swinging are greatly enhanced. The physiotherapy probe 4 can be more accurately adjusted in position according to the body type and needs of the patient, ensuring accurate coverage of the treatment area while reducing discomfort caused by probe shaking. The swing seat 14 is provided with guide wheels 15 on both sides, and arc-shaped guide rails one 16 and arc-shaped guide rails two 17 that cooperate with the guide wheels 15 are symmetrically installed on the inner wall of the arc-shaped support housing 11. This structure optimizes the sliding and guiding mechanism: the guide wheels 15 installed on both sides of the swing seat 14 cooperate with the arc-shaped guide rails one 16 and arc-shaped guide rails two 17 on the inner wall of the arc-shaped support housing 11 to form a stable and smooth sliding and guiding system. This design not only reduces friction and resistance during swinging, improving the smoothness of sliding, but also ensures the stability and accuracy of the swing seat 14 during sliding, avoiding treatment errors caused by deviation or jamming. In addition, the cooperation of the guide wheels 15 and the arc-shaped guide rails one 16 and arc-shaped guide rails two 17 reduces direct contact and wear, thereby prolonging the service life of the equipment. At the same time, since the physiotherapy probe 4 and the swing seat 14 are detachable, when cleaning, maintenance or replacement is needed, it can be operated conveniently and quickly, reducing maintenance cost and time cost. By optimizing the swinging mechanism of the physiotherapy probe 4, the entire treatment process is more stable and comfortable, reducing the nervousness and discomfort of the patient. At the same time, accurate physiotherapy position adjustment also improves the treatment effect, enhances the treatment confidence and satisfaction of the patient.

[0039] The semi-annular support 35 is provided with a swing driving mechanism 37 for driving the physiotherapy probe 4 to swing left and right; the semi-annular support 35 is respectively installed at both sides of the physiotherapy bed 34, and the physiotherapy bed 34 is provided with a horizontal movement driving mechanism 36 for driving the semi-annular support 35 to move along the length direction of the physiotherapy bed 34; wherein the swing driving mechanism 37 comprises a synchronous belt machine 18 installed in the arc-shaped support shell 11 along the swing direction of the physiotherapy probe 4, the synchronous belt machine 18 comprises a synchronous belt and driving pulleys and driven pulleys installed at both ends of the arc-shaped support shell 11, a transmission rack part 19 is circumferentially installed at the middle position of the outer transmission surface of the synchronous belt, and a transmission tooth 20 cooperating with the transmission rack part 19 is installed on the swing seat 14, wherein the synchronous belt drives the swing seat 14 to swing along the arc-shaped guide rail one 16 and the arc-shaped guide rail two 17; wherein a guide guard plate 21 is installed in the arc-shaped support shell 11 corresponding to the position below the synchronous belt machine 18, the transmission tooth 20 of the swing seat 14 penetrates from the clamping slot formed by the two guide guard plates 21, and the top of the swing seat 14 is in sliding contact with the inner ring surface of the arc-shaped support shell 11.
